Transaction 3cdf7d34e97f3291698937c88ee7703f49b33081da63107c8270afa474bf8109

1 Input
2 Outputs
  • 3cdf7d34e97f3291698937c88ee7703f49b33081da63107c8270afa474bf8109:0
  • value  500000
    address  3GWN2RJuyLQiDvj8YPNUvmRBqCXsbbBhLv
  • 3cdf7d34e97f3291698937c88ee7703f49b33081da63107c8270afa474bf8109:1
  • value  552584
    address  1EwADsELrbE5PGWoegiEobEu77k721PttK